Understanding Humidity in Grow Tents

What is Humidity?

Humidity refers to the amount of water vapor present in the air. It plays a crucial role in plant health, affecting transpiration rates and nutrient uptake. Plants often prefer higher humidity levels, which can range from 40% to 70%, depending on their species.

Why is Humidity Crucial for Indoor Plants?

Higher humidity levels allow plants to absorb moisture more easily through their leaves and roots. This is especially important for tropical plants or seedlings that are still developing their root systems.

Effects of Low Humidity on Plants

Low humidity can lead to stress in plants, causing wilting, leaf drop, or stunted growth. Moreover, certain pests thrive under dry conditions; hence maintaining optimal humidity can also deter infestations.

How to Increase Humidity in a Grow Tent Naturally

1. Utilize Water Sources

One of the simplest ways to boost humidity is by placing open containers of water inside the grow tent. The water will evaporate and increase moisture levels in the air.

1.1 Positioning Water Containers

    Place shallow trays filled with water on shelves within the tent. Use larger containers if space allows.

2. Employ Natural Evaporation Techniques

Misting your plants with water not only hydrates them but also raises ambient humidity levels temporarily.

2.1 Misting Guidelines

    Mist in the morning when temperatures are cooler. Use distilled water if possible to avoid mineral buildup.

3. Add Organic Mulch

Organic materials like straw or peat moss retain moisture well and release it gradually into the air.

4. Grouping Plants Together

When plants are clustered together, they create a microenvironment that enhances moisture retention through transpiration.
